Director Of Information Technology | Abc Owned Television Stations GroupThe Walt Disney Company Mar 2016 - Feb 2020Greater Los Angeles AreaMoved 9 different business units from disparate processes and systems to common shared workflows and systems in areas including vulnerability scanning, computer imaging, account provisioning, network monitoring, vendor account management, IT Asset inventory, and patch management. Built and managed the team that maintained and operated the centralized systems.Responsible for IT Infrastructure design and implementation for centralization of Master Control operations for 8 Broadcast Television stations using high speed wan transport for moving heavy multicast video streams and large video files between the central hub and the eight stations.Negotiated contracts and deals with sourcing, legal and vendors.Planned and executed the divisions' initial move to the cloud with implementation of AWS based journalist facing editorial systems and hybrid on prem/cloud large file transfer systems.Selected technology, designed, and completed implementation, to micro-segment nine sites into many trust zones behind Palo Alto firewalls in preparation for the switch to zero trust.Led the selection of a new editorial vendor for eight newsrooms, replacing and combining numerous outdated systems into one integrated file based video and editorial production system. -
Director Of Broadcast Technologies | Kabc TelevisionKabc-Tv / Disney Apr 2000 - Mar 2016Greater Los Angeles AreaI was recruited to help with the transition to a new building and complete the automation of master control and news workflows, moving from tape based to file based digital workflows. I built the IT Department of two people and a few dozen computers into the Broadcast Technology department with seven staff and over 1,800 networked devices. Under my direction, the department installed and now manages computerized news and production editing and playout systems, IP based SNG systems, IP based live truck editing and control systems, VoIP Telephones. -
